INGREDIENTS

Cider
Brandy
Cloves
Star anise
Orange skin
Cinnamon Sticks

METHOD

• Pour your cider into a saucepan.
• Pop in your spices such as cloves, star anise and cinnamon sticks.
• Put a lid on the pan and leave to heat gently on a very low heat for as long as needed.
(Longer the better if you want your guests to smell the delicious aromas when they enter your home).
• Serve in cute mugs with a slice of orange skin and a dash of brandy.
